Understanding the Kooch County Jail Roster
The Kooch County jail roster is essentially a publicly accessible list or database that contains detailed information on individuals who are currently detained at the county jail facility. This roster is maintained by the Kooch County Sheriff's Office or the local corrections department and is updated regularly to reflect new bookings, releases, and transfers.
What Information Does the Jail Roster Include?
When you access the Kooch County jail roster, you can typically expect to find the following details about each inmate:
- Full Name: To clearly identify the individual.
- Booking Date and Time: When the person was admitted to the facility.
- Charges: The alleged offenses for which the person was arrested.
- Bail or Bond Information: Details on whether the inmate is eligible for bail and the bond amount.
- Inmate ID Number: A unique identifier used within the jail system.
- Custody Status: Whether the inmate is currently in custody, released, or transferred.
- Booking Photo (Mugshot): An image taken at the time of booking, if available.
This information not only helps families and legal representatives stay informed but also promotes transparency within the criminal justice system.

Booking and Intake Process
When someone is arrested in Kooch County, they go through a booking process that includes photographing, fingerprinting, and recording personal information. This data populates the jail roster.
Visitation Rules
Visiting an inmate typically requires adherence to strict guidelines, including scheduling visits, providing identification, and following dress codes. The jail roster website often provides these details to make planning a visit easier.
Release Procedures
Inmates may be released upon posting bail, serving their sentence, or other legal actions. The roster is updated to reflect these changes, helping families know when a loved one is coming home.
